David nodax added new product for sell.
3 years ago


United Kingdom, London, UK

Kara Brothers Orchards is a family-owned and operated business that produces gummy bears made from 100% natural, organic ingredients. The company was founded in 2014 by brothers Adam and Brian Benham. CBD Gummy bears are widely available throughout North America, but not outside of Europe. Since launching their business here in October 2016, the Benham brothers have been overwhelmed by the positive response they have received from consumers across North America and Europe.


Type New
Price 4.9.00
OrderBuy now